WHY PORTUGAL?
Portugal has become one of the most loved destination wedding locations in Europe — and it’s easy to see why:
- ✦ Direct flights from London, Manchester, New York, Boston, LA…
- ✦ Way more affordable than France or Italy (without losing the charm)
- ✦ Dreamy wedding venues: vineyards, cliffs, modern design spots
- ✦ Epic light, great wine, and a super relaxed vibe
- ✦ Friendly vendors who speak English and know how to party
From the Algarve’s golden beaches to the dramatic cliffs of Sintra or the vineyards of Douro Valley — there’s a perfect spot for every kind of couple.

Do we need to speak Portuguese?
Not at all. Most of your planning can be done in English. We’re fluent, and so are most of the vendors we recommend.
What’s the legal process to get married in Portugal as a foreigner?
It’s possible to do the legal part here, but many couples do the paperwork at home and have a symbolic ceremony in Portugal. It’s more flexible and stress-free.
How far in advance should we book?
Ideally 9–12 months for peak dates. But if your plans are last-minute, reach out — we’ll see what we can do.
